Re: zoo worker

(Anonymous) 2016-05-04 02:13 am (UTC)(link)
I love watching bears wander around. they're very expressive and curious animals and I could watch them roll about and scratch their heads with their back paws for hours. I used to not really have an opinion on apes but after being close to chimps for this long I've really come to loathe them. My boss describes them perfectly as "perpetual teenagers who are put in prison." they hold the exact same temperament for the rest of their life after they turn two years old.

(calling a zoo "prison" is a joke, the animals are very content and have ample space to run about. just in case anyone comes in rallying to free the animals a la Curly from Hey Arnold)

Re: zoo worker

(Anonymous) 2016-05-04 02:21 am (UTC)(link)
their indoor containment has a hallway right beside it that I have to walk down to do work. my boss told me, "Take a trash can lid with you," and I didn't understand, so I just grabbed one and held it while walking past. the bars are criss-crossed like chain link fence in a way, and yet I still instantly got feces thrown at me through it and one of the chimps threw a plastic outdoor toy against the door in an effort to scare me. worked very well. I realized that the lid was a poop shield.

chimps are horrifyingly smart.
